Senior Vice President of Strategic Projects & Government Affairs Enterra Solutions, LLC As Senior Vice President of Strategic Projects & Government Affairs, Keith works directly with the CEO and other members of the company’s senior leadership team on legislative issues that impact the company’s ability to assist public and private sector clients. He is also responsible for oversight of designated strategic projects. He joined Enterra Solutions from the United Service Organizations (USO) where he served first as Senior Vice President of Operations and then as Chief Operating Officer. In that role, he directed core global operations, including: strategic planning, service delivery, entertainment programs, marketing, budget management, and development. He was accountable for 300+ employees and 26,000 volunteers worldwide. Annually, the USO supports 2.6 million military personnel and their families at 130 locations in the United States and around the world. Prior to working with the USO, Keith worked as an investment advisor at UBS where he provided a full range of investment advice to individual investors and small businesses. He joined UBS following a successful 24-year career as a Naval Flight Officer in the United State Navy. Keith served as Commanding Officer of Patrol Squadron Twenty-Three and as Commander, Patrol Wing Eleven, Naval Air Station Jacksonville. His non-flying billets included assignments aboard the USS Coral Sea (CV-43), as Flag Aide to the Commander, Navy Recruiting Command, on the staff of the Chief of Naval Operations, and as Deputy Executive Secretary in the Immediate Office of the Secretary of Defense. Keith’s final military assignment was with the Office of the Assistant Secretary of Defense (Legislative Affairs) as the Special Assistant for Weapons Systems Acquisition Policy. He earned his BS from the United States Naval Academy. He also earned two Master’s degrees, an MA in International Relations from the United States Naval War College and an MS in Management from Salve Regina University. Additionally, Keith served a Defense Fellowship at Syracuse University’s Maxwell School. He currently serves on the Board of Directors of the Military Officers Association of America. |
